IDEA中切換不同版本的JDK的詳細教程(超管用)
背景:
領導給我了個eclipse開發(fā)的代碼,我導入到了IDEA中,一直拿JDK1.8進行的開發(fā),完事之后發(fā)現(xiàn)服務器環(huán)境是JDK1.7,那就再IDE中直接換JDK重新編譯唄,沒想到一路坎坷。
**
請看到最后
**
網(wǎng)上的一般方法:
步驟一:
選擇SDK,導入相應的JDK所在文件夾。
步驟二:
選擇模塊默認使用的jdk語言標準
步驟三:
導入jdk對應版本的原生依賴
步驟四:
設置好SDK的默認值
如果還是不行,又出現(xiàn)了步驟五:
反正我是都搞了,而且還把jdk1.8給卸載了,然并卵,還是提示我無法編譯。
最重要的步驟來了
如果通過上面五步還是沒能搞定的話,可以試試這個。
把這個默認的選項去除掉試試,反正我這么做,之后就可以了,再有如果導入多模塊,每個模塊jdk版本不同,也要去除這個選項。
多模塊的話,在這里指定好版本,去除下面第一個默認選項就行。
到此這篇關于IDEA中切換不同版本的JDK的詳細教程(超管用)的文章就介紹到這了,更多相關idea切換不同版本的JDK內(nèi)容請搜索腳本之家以前的文章或繼續(xù)瀏覽下面的相關文章希望大家以后多多支持腳本之家!
相關文章
Redis結合AOP與自定義注解實現(xiàn)分布式緩存流程詳解
項目中如果查詢數(shù)據(jù)是直接到MySQL數(shù)據(jù)庫中查詢的話,會查磁盤走IO,效率會比較低,所以現(xiàn)在一般項目中都會使用緩存,目的就是提高查詢數(shù)據(jù)的速度,將數(shù)據(jù)存入緩存中,也就是內(nèi)存中,這樣查詢效率大大提高2022-11-11Maven打包所有依賴到一個可執(zhí)行jar中遇到的問題
這篇文章主要給大家介紹了關于Maven打包所有依賴到一個可執(zhí)行jar中遇到的問題,將依賴打入jar包,由于maven管理了所有的依賴,所以將項目的代碼和依賴打成一個包對它來說是順理成章的功能,需要的朋友可以參考下2023-10-10Springboot報錯java.lang.NullPointerException: null問題
這篇文章主要介紹了Springboot報錯java.lang.NullPointerException: null問題,具有很好的參考價值,希望對大家有所幫助,如有錯誤或未考慮完全的地方,望不吝賜教2023-11-11Java?GUI實現(xiàn)學生成績管理系統(tǒng)
這篇文章主要為大家詳細介紹了Java?GUI實現(xiàn)學生成績管理系統(tǒng),文中示例代碼介紹的非常詳細,具有一定的參考價值,感興趣的小伙伴們可以參考一下2018-01-01